The Lady Stallions of South Lawrence traveled to Summertown Monday night to take on a familiar foe.
The game started off slow for both teams, but the Stallions would go on a run lead by Audrey Cotton who had one kill and 2 aces in the game. South Lawrence would quickly take a 15-6 lead before Summertown called their first timeout.
Summertown would come out of the timeout hot and go on a run to shorten the gap. Phoenix Moyer would help the Eagles on the comeback with one block and two kills during the first set.
South Lawrence would win a close first set 25-23.
Summertown jumped to a quick 7-2 lead at the start of the second set forcing South Lawrence to call a timeout.
Alex Rigsby led the charge in the second set with two kills and one ace in the game.
The Lady Stallions would shift the momentum to tie the second set 18-18. Lilly Augustin took over during the run as she had three kills for the Lady Stallions.
Summertown would pull away in a close one to win the second set 25-22.
Macy Pettus and Ava Cornelius led the way for the Eagles with each having four kills and one ace in the game.
Coming down to the wire the Lady Stallions would take a 14-8 lead forcing Summertown to take a timeout.
Shanna Fisher would take over in the third set with one block and three kills in the game as South Lawrence was one point away from the win.
The Lady Eagles would go on a 6-0 run out of the timeout to tie the final set 14-14.
South Lawrence would take its final timeout to halt the Lady Eagles momentum. The Lady Stallions would take the next two points to win the game 16-14.
